Tikka guys, explain it to me simply please. If I have a tikka factory take off barrel, can I put that barrel on a different tikka action without doing anything besides torqueing it down and checking headspace?

Pretty much. Threads likely won't time. But headspace will likely be good, be sure to check it for safety purposes though.
 
“Build” is a stretch, but here’s mine: set up for backcountry deer in the big, thick woods of the northeast.
T3x lite, with 20” chopped barrel, high desert bottom metal, hand painted stockys carbon stock, Leupold 2.5-8x scope. 7mm-08. I shoot 140 grain e-tips over a stout charge of Big Game. 6.85 pounds with scope.
